You head back inside the room with the cylinder full of liquid, and ask if anyone wants some. Ulla turns it down, as does Alca, but Usun takes a swig and grimaces.

"I've never had a taste for sweet stuff." he says. You tell him you wouldn't know. You haven't had much of a chance to get to know each other.

When you ask if anyone wants to explore with you, they all exchange glances.

"We're going to stay here. If you get caught and they don't like it, it'll be better if we can say you're a rogue agent. We don't have much choice but extreme caution right now." says Ulla as softly as you've seen her speak. By which you mean with the same tender loving care of a large hammer. "Go ahead if you want, but we're going to stay here and try to speak with them."

There are two doors yet unexplored in the hallway. On is directly ahead, the other to the side. The door to the observation room is still open, and you haven't fully examined everything in there yet. You got distracted by the stuff. the... stuffy stuff. Whatever.

You hiccup slightly. All you know is you can hardly stay in one room forever.
